Catalonia police dismantle multiple criminal groups and investigate fatal stabbing
Several criminal activities and law enforcement operations have been reported across Catalonia. In Manresa, a 45-year-old gardener named Carles Vilajosana was fatally stabbed. The murder has caused significant local shock, leading the Manresa City Council to declare a day of mourning.
In Beneixama, the Guàrdia Civil dismantled a criminal group responsible for stealing approximately 2.4 kilometers of copper cable from an electrical substation. The operation, named ‘Subcob’, resulted in the arrest of seven men. The stolen material was reportedly traced to a metal recycling center in Alicante.
In the Tarragona region, Mossos d’Esquadra dismantled three marijuana plantations in Montmell and Querol, seizing 1,751 plants. The operation also led to the arrest of three men for crimes including public health offenses and electricity fraud. Additionally, police in Salt arrested two men for vehicle burglaries, while a 52-year-old man was detained in La Móra for stealing electronic devices from a home.
In Lleida, a 50-year-old man was arrested for an armed robbery at a supermarket in the Clot neighborhood, where he used an air pistol to intimidate workers and steal cash.
